news Immigrants’ Lawyers Say U.S. Is Redacting Documents Proving Legal Status By AdminSeptember 14, 2026Less 1 min read2 Views0 Many noncitizens need immigration records the government has to prove their legal stay and resist deportation. The government is redacting and withholding those documents, lawyers say.
